The new kid just learned to walk(1).
http://git.9front.org/plan9front/plan9front/HEAD/sys/src/cmd...
329 lines of code.
For nix: https://github.com/google/walk
You can also use dmenu's stest to do the equivalent to find's -type f, { walk $PWD | stest -f }